After serenading the Apollo Theater crowd with the soulful single by Al Green, “Let’s Stay Together,” President Barack Obama says he will take on a Young Jeezy tune for his next musical number.
In my first term I sang Al Green, in my second term I’m going with Young Jeezy
The audience at the 2012 White House Correspondents’ Dinner laughed while Michelle Obama cosigned the notion with a “Yeaa“. I guess the Obama‘s are fans of the rapper. After all, he did pay homage with the release of, “My President” back in 2008.
